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
½ lb. tenderloin center cut prime boneless steak, cut in half
salt & pepper
butter
margarine

Directions:
Directions:
Season steaks generously with salt and pepper. Add a spoon of butter and a spoon of frying margarine to frying pan, raise heat to high, add the steak and fry, turning until nice and golden browned, about 5-7 minutes for the first side, and 3-4 minutes on the second side, for medium-rare.

A simple and enjoyable meal for just the two of you! As you all might know by now, we love going to Redfish (aka Sexfish) Island. For a Saturday night treat we sometimes buy a 0.5 lb. tenderloin steak, cut it in half and then pan fry. Add a fried potato or favorite potato chips, a tossed salad and a glass of wine. Watch the sunset and enjoy a nice peaceful night at anchor. Don't forget to put out a liberal scope of anchor chain for peace of mind.
